Troll Pub Under the Bridge

On our most recent trip to the Louisville, Kentucky, we stopped at a very HIDDEN restaurant called Troll Pub Under the Bridge .  When we say under the bridge, it practically is under a bridge. The only way to enter the building is by making your way past the giant troll, and walking down the stairs to the underground restaurant. It's a very unique dining experience. It has such a secluded and make-believable feel to it while inside. Also, check out this gnarly troll scaling the stairway. He's a fun photo opportunity.  The food menu and drink  menu are both pretty big with lots of options. We decided to go with a the beer cheese burger and the tender dinner. The very original beer cheese burger had a simple set up. It included the meat patty, smoked fried onions, and beer cheese, all on a salted pretzel bun. It was a very decent burger. Do-Rite Donuts

We will keep this one short and sweet! Do-Rite Donuts , found in Chicago We stumbled into Do-Rite in a hurry, as this was sadly our last day in Chicago. I sent Seth in and he grabbed us a couple and hurried back to our car. We we’re sad to be headed home, but the donuts definitely brought us a little bit of cheer! As for me, he got me the Pistachio. It had a good flavor, but since we did not get in until later in the day you could tell they were not as fresh as they probably usually are. The texture was my favorite part, they were both cake donuts, and oh so crumbly. Seth picked out a chocolate covered cake donut, and it was good as well.  We hope to go back some day in the future and try out more of their donuts earlier in the day!
